Common Causes of Blower Downtime

Blower problems often start small — a worn belt, a clogged filter, or slight misalignment — but escalate quickly if not addressed. Here are some of the most common issues Chattanooga businesses face:

Bearing Failure
Bearings support the blower’s rotating components, and when they wear out, you’ll notice vibration, noise, and heat. Left unchecked, bearing failure can cause catastrophic damage.

Belt Wear or Slippage
Loose or worn belts reduce airflow and put strain on the motor. Eventually, the blower can stall completely.

Clogged Filters or Intake Screens
A blocked intake forces the blower to work harder, increasing energy consumption and heat buildup.

Improper Lubrication
Too much or too little lubrication can lead to premature component wear.

Electrical Issues
Faulty wiring, motor failures, or control panel issues can stop a blower in its tracks.

The Case for Preventative Maintenance

Preventative maintenance is the most cost-effective way to avoid blower downtime. Here’s what it typically includes:

1. Regular Inspections

Check for unusual noises or vibrations

Inspect belts, bearings, and seals

Verify airflow and pressure levels

2. Lubrication Schedule

Follow the manufacturer’s guidelines for lubrication frequency and type. In Chattanooga’s humid climate, ensuring proper lubricant integrity is especially important.

3. Filter and Screen Cleaning

Keeping intake filters and screens clean reduces strain on the blower and prevents overheating.

4. Alignment Checks

Proper alignment of the motor and blower ensures even load distribution, reducing wear.

5. Performance Monitoring

Recording airflow, pressure, and motor amps over time helps spot problems before they cause failure.

Local Climate and Environmental Challenges

Chattanooga’s weather plays a role in blower performance:

High summer humidity can cause corrosion if condensate isn’t properly managed.

Dust from manufacturing environments can clog intakes faster than expected.

Temperature swings can affect lubrication viscosity and seal performance.

Having a maintenance provider familiar with these conditions can help prevent climate-related failures.

Emergency Repair Best Practices

If a blower fails unexpectedly:

Shut it down immediately to prevent further damage.

Contact your service provider — ideally one with 24/7 availability.

Provide system details — model, serial number, and recent service history help speed repairs.

Check related systems — sometimes blower failure is caused by an upstream or downstream issue.

The Role of Predictive Maintenance

Predictive maintenance uses data collection tools like vibration analysis and thermography to detect early signs of failure.

For example:

A sudden change in vibration frequency might indicate bearing wear.

Increased motor heat could mean impending electrical issues.

Integrating predictive maintenance into your service plan helps Chattanooga businesses schedule repairs during planned downtime instead of reacting to emergencies.

Energy Efficiency Gains

Healthy blowers aren’t just more reliable — they’re more efficient. A clogged filter or misaligned pulley forces the blower to consume more energy for the same output.

Chattanooga facilities looking to cut costs and reduce environmental impact can benefit from pairing blower maintenance with energy audits. In many cases, optimizing blower systems leads to double-digit percentage drops in energy usage.
